Kirsten Flagstad
Kirsten Malfrid Flagstad was a Norwegian opera singer and a highly regarded Wagnerian soprano. She ranks among the greatest singers of the 20th century, and many opera critics called hers "the voice of the century." Desmond Shawe-Taylor wrote of her in the New Grove Dictionary of Opera: "No one within living memory surpassed her in sheer beauty and consistency of line and tone."
Kirsten Rausing
Kirsten Elisbet Rausing, DL owns a third of the holding company Tetra Laval and sits on the company board alongside other members of her family. She was listed as the 150th richest individual in the world in the Forbes 2020 list of The World's Billionaires.

Kirsten Thorup
Kirsten Thorup, a Danish author, was born in Gelsted, Funen, Denmark in 1942 and now lives in Copenhagen. She is the author of three poetry collections, a volume of short stories, and three novels including Baby which has been translated into English. She has also written for films, television, and radio. Her novel, Den lange sommer, was published in Denmark in 1979.
Kirsten Sheridan
Kirsten Sheridan is an Irish film director and screenwriter. The director of August Rush (2007) and Disco Pigs (2001), Sheridan was nominated for an Academy Award for co-writing the semi-autobiographical film In America with her father, director Jim Sheridan, and her sister, Naomi Sheridan.
Kirsten Rolffes
Kirsten Rolffes was a Danish actress, internationally mostly recognized for her roles in The Kingdom and Matador. She also had a leading role in Denmark's first sitcom, Een stor familie, set in an early 1980s office building. She attended drama school at Frederiksberg Theater (1947-48) and at the National Theater.

Kirsten Tackmann
Kirsten Tackmann is a German politician. Born in Schmalkalden, Thuringia, she represents The Left. Kirsten Tackmann has served as a member of the Bundestag from the state of Brandenburg since 2005.
